Museum Virtual – Exhibition Award 2021

Since 2020, under the conditions of the Corona pandemic, numerous museums have entered the virtual space with their exhibition or have expanded their presence there. Thus, the contact and exchange with the visitors could be maintained, despite often closed doors. Since then, the Museum for Sepulchral Culture has also been represented on Museum Virtuell with all its exhibitions since 2020. The rooms, texts and exhibits can be experienced in 360° mode thanks to modern 3D technology. These elaborate scans of the exhibitions are supported and produced by the managing director of Museum Virtuell, Dirk Leiber.

In 2021, the digital platform Museum Virtuell will award its own exhibition prize for the first time. According to the jury's decision, the 2021 exhibition prize will go to the Museum for Sepulchral Culture in Kassel and honor the exhibition "Suizid – Let's talk about it!" Actor Hendrik Duryn (known, for example, from "The Teacher," RTL) will present it to the museum in February. On February 18, a virtual tour is planned in the cinema "Goli-Theater" in Goch on the Lower Rhine. During this tour on the big cinema screen, museum director Dr. Dirk Pörschmann will guide viewers* through the museum from Kassel. Hendrik Duryn will be present in person at the cinema and will initiate a discussion together with expert consultant and psychiatrist Dr. Wolfgang Komhard and managing director Dirk Leiber.

"Everyone knows someone who has had to deal with it. There are people who have tried to take their own lives, relatives who can't get out of brooding, patients who can no longer see any other ways out of their suffering, society that casts prejudice on it, legislators who regulate it, associations that support it," writes Dirk Leiber about the winning exhibition.
